What You’ll Do- Execute structured drone test flights in manual and autonomous modes, adjusting flight parameters as test conditions evolve.
- Perform daily pre‑flight and post‑flight procedures, including equipment prep, battery management, and test‑site logistics.
- Work in real‑world field environments, including standing for long periods and handling drones repeatedly in varying weather (heat, cold, wind, dust, etc.).
- Collaborate closely with engineering and flight teams to report observations, flag anomalies, and support iterative design/testing cycles.
- Contribute to safe, efficient, and high‑quality flight test operations every day.

What Makes You a Great Fit- FAA Part 107 Certified with 100+ logged flight hours across diverse environments.
- Skilled in FPV/Acro Mode flying.
- Strong understanding of FAA rules, airspace classes, risk management, and safe flight practices.
- Technical curiosity and the ability to troubleshoot drone systems during testing.
- Strong analytical mindset—you can spot anomalies, document findings, and help iterate on fixes.
- Hands‑on experience supporting drone development, aerospace testing, or robotics programs.
- Ability to fly multiple modes, collect accurate data, and provide thoughtful feedback to engineering.
- Clear communication skills—whether writing flight logs, documenting issues, or surfacing blockers to leads.
